In the context of the Military Decision-Making Process (MDMP), the Course of Action (COA) Development step focuses on devising several viable strategies to achieve the mission objectives. This step involves analyzing friendly and enemy forces, designing various courses of action, and assessing the potential outcomes of these actions to determine their feasibility and effectiveness.

The production of orders, however, is not part of the COA Development step. Instead, it occurs later in the process after a preferred course of action has been selected. Therefore, while the other components directly contribute to generating and refining the courses of action, order production is a separate activity that takes place in the subsequent steps of MDMP, specifically during the Orders Production step.
